The Intersection of Ethics and AI: A Growing Priority

One of the most compelling trends in AI and ML is the increasing emphasis on ethical considerations. As AI systems become more integrated into daily life, the need for ethical guidelines and standards becomes paramount. The Global Certificate in Knowledge Standards for AI and Machine Learning Applications places a strong emphasis on this area, ensuring that professionals are well-versed in the ethical implications of their work.

Ethical AI is not just about avoiding bias in algorithms; it's about creating systems that are transparent, accountable, and beneficial to society. The course explores topics such as data privacy, algorithmic fairness, and the societal impact of AI. For instance, understanding how to mitigate bias in facial recognition systems or ensuring that AI-driven decisions in healthcare are equitable are critical skills that the certificate equips students with.

Integrating AI with IoT: The Next Big Thing

The convergence of AI and the Internet of Things (IoT) is another trend that the Global Certificate in Knowledge Standards for AI and Machine Learning Applications addresses. As more devices become connected, the amount of data generated is exponentially increasing. AI and ML algorithms are essential for making sense of this data and extracting actionable insights.

For example, in smart cities, AI can optimize traffic flow by analyzing real-time data from IoT sensors. In industrial settings, predictive maintenance systems powered by AI can reduce downtime and improve efficiency. The certificate program provides hands-on experience with IoT integration, teaching students how to develop and deploy AI models that can interact with IoT devices seamlessly.

Edge Computing and AI: Bringing Intelligence to the Edge

Edge computing, which involves processing data closer to where it is collected, is another area of innovation that the certificate covers. Traditional cloud computing models can introduce latency issues, making them less suitable for real-time applications. Edge computing addresses this by bringing the processing power closer to the data source, enabling faster decision-making.

The Global Certificate in Knowledge Standards for AI and Machine Learning Applications includes modules on edge computing, teaching students how to develop AI models that can run efficiently on edge devices. This is particularly relevant for applications in autonomous vehicles, drones, and augmented reality, where real-time processing is crucial.

The Future of AI: Quantum Computing and Beyond

Quantum computing represents the next frontier in AI and ML. Quantum computers have the potential to solve complex problems that are currently infeasible for classical computers. While quantum computing is still in its early stages, the Global Certificate in Knowledge Standards for AI and Machine Learning Applications is already incorporating foundational knowledge in this area.

Students gain insights into how quantum algorithms can enhance AI capabilities, from optimization problems to complex simulations. By staying ahead of this emerging technology, the certificate ensures that graduates are ready to leverage quantum computing when it becomes more mainstream.
